Methodology
Zinc density and calculation basis
Zinc is represented in this table by a fixed reference density of 7140 kg/m^3, equivalent to 7.14 g/cm^3. Standard engineering density for zinc.
At this fixed reference, 1 liter of Zinc corresponds to 7.14 kg, while 1 kg corresponds to 0.140056 liters. Its table density is 616.1% higher than the 997 kg/m^3 water reference used in this dataset.
Among the 13 fixed table records labeled Metals, the nearest density to Zinc is Cast Iron at 7200 kg/m^3: an absolute difference of 60 kg/m^3 (0.8% relative to Zinc). 2 records have a lower fixed density and 10 have a higher one. The observed range in this labeled group is Aluminum at 2700 kg/m^3 to Gold at 19320 kg/m^3. This is a numerical comparison, not a claim that the materials are interchangeable.
For this direction, mass is calculated as volume multiplied by density after normalizing the units to cubic meters and kilograms. The resulting page multiplier is 27,027.84 g per gal (US).
The fixed value supports repeatable calculations but is not a batch, grade, supplier, or laboratory specification. Use a measured or certified density when those conditions control the result.
